The male sage grouse has air sacs that when not inflated, lie hidden beneath the grouse’s neck feathers. During its spring courtship ritual, the male sage grouse inflates these air sacs and displays them to the female sage grouse. Some scientists hypothesize that this courtship ritual serves as a means for female sage grouse to select healthy mates.
Which one of the following, if true, most strongly supports the scientists’ hypothesis?
(A) Some female sage grouse mate with unhealthy male sage grouse.
(B) When diseased male sage grouse were treated with antibiotics, they were not selected by female sage grouse during the courtship ritual.
(C) Some healthy male sages grouse do not inflate their air sacs as part of the courtship ritual.
(D) Male sage grouse are prone to parasitic infections that exhibit symptoms visible on the birds’ air sacs.
(E) The sage grouse is commonly afflicted with a strain of malaria that tends to change as the organism that causes it undergoes mutation.
